Before hiring a biohazard or hoarding cleanup company, there’s one question that deserves more attention:
Who will actually be inside your home?
Cleanup technicians may spend hours or days working in private areas of a property, often around valuables, documents, fi****ms, medications, and sentimental belongings.
That’s why homeowners should ask about more than price.
Ask about:
Technician training
Years of experience
How long employees have been with the company
Whether subcontractors or temporary labor are used
Documentation procedures
How valuables are handled
Who supervises the work
What accountability procedures are in place
A lower estimate may be attractive, but trust, experience, and accountability matter when you’re giving a company access to your home.
